"We've been working to make it easier to run GNURADIO with a specific set of hardware to enable radio astronomy. Here is a Raspberry Pi 4 OS copy that has been gzip compressed down to 2.5 GB. This version is configured to run Gnuradio, gnu radio-companion and radio astronomy graphs. It seems to work out of the box when using wired ethernet. The WVURAIL designs from GitHub are pre-installed and tested. ( i.e. git clone http://github.com/WVURAIL/gr-radio_astro) The analysis software from is also preloaded and copied into the /home/pi/bin directory. For documentation see. (i.e. git clone http://github.com/glangsto/analyze) The un-gziped image is big, 32 GB. Using dd on a linux box this can be copied directly to an SD card and inserted into Raspberry PI 4 and Pi 3 B+. The OS has been tweaked for static IP addresses, enabling an array of radio telescopes. For wifi, a tweak is required to /etc/dhcpcd.conf Good Luck! Glen "
